Cranberry Chocolate Chunk Air Fryer Cookies

PREP TIME 10 min

COOK TIME 36 MIN

Approx 2 dozen cookies

Ingredients:

  • 2 1/2 cups flour
  • 1 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 1 cup (2 sticks) butter, softened
  • 3/4 cup granulated sugar
  • 3/4 cup firmly packed brown sugar
  • 1 tablespoon McCormick® All Natural Pure Vanilla Extract
  • 2 eggs
  • 1 cup Ocean Spray® Craisins® Dried Cranberries
  • 1 cup chopped dark chocolate
  • 1 cup chopped pecans, toasted (optional)

Directions:

  1. Mix flour, baking soda and salt in medium bowl. Set aside. Beat butter and sugars in large bowl with electric mixer on medium speed until well blended, about 1 to 2 minutes. Add eggs, one at a time, beating after each addition. Stir in vanilla. Reduce speed to low and gradually add flour mixture; mix just until blended. Stir in Craisins®, chocolate chips and pecans.
  2. Preheat air fryer on 325°F for 2 minutes. Set to cook 14 minutes. (Use the BAKE setting if your air fryer has one.) Cut parchment paper to line air fryer basket or racks, cutting several small slits in paper to allow air to flow through. Trim parchment, leaving space around edges of air fryer basket or rack, so that air can circulate.
  3. Scoop dough, using a 1/4-cup measuring cup or scoop, and place about 2-inches apart onto prepared parchment; flatten slightly. Place parchment liner and cookie dough in air fryer basket. Air fry 12 to 14 minutes or until golden brown and toothpick inserted in center comes out mostly clean. Let stand in air fryer 1 minute. Use a thin spatula to transfer cookies to wire rack; cool completely. Repeat with remaining dough.
